The First National Bank of Central Texas Announces Several Executive Promotions

December 20, 2020

The board of directors of Waco-based The First National Bank of Central Texas (FNBCT) unanimously approved officer promotions during its December meeting.

Steve Gohring has been promoted to chief operating officer. He brings nearly four decades of banking experience to his new position. He’s worked in the operations department at FNBCT since 2015.

John Low has been promoted to executive vice president. He started his banking career in 1981 while he was still a student at Baylor University as a part-time teller. Over the past 39 years, he has become one of the most respected commercial lenders in Waco. He has been a part of the FNBCT team since 2006.

Evan Hankins was promoted to senior vice president and chief financial officer. He has been with FNBCT since 2009 and has more than 14 years of community banking experience. The Baylor University graduate has filled many roles during his time as a banker, including teller, credit analyst and lender.

David Brennan has been named banking center president for FNBCT’s Woodway-Hewitt location. He brings more than 20 years of community banking experience to his new role. He has been with FNBCT since the fall of 2019.

“These members of our team are not only good bankers, but they are great people, too,” says Sloan Kuehl, executive vice president and chief lending officer. “We are excited to be able to recognize their hard work and dedication with these promotions.”

Established in 1901, The First National Bank of Central Texas operates branches in Waco, China Spring, Woodway/Hewitt, Hillsboro and Mart.
